如何在ModelSimSE中添加ALTERA仿真库并使用DO文件进行功能仿真?请提供详细的步骤和示例。
时间: 2024-11-17 07:27:05 浏览: 19
在进行ModelSimSE仿真的过程中,添加ALTERA仿真库并使用DO文件可以提高仿真效率和可重复性。以下是一些详细步骤和示例:
参考资源链接:[ModelSim学习笔记:初学者指南](https://wenku.csdn.net/doc/sjuzgy8b58?spm=1055.2569.3001.10343)
首先,确保你已经安装了ALTERA的ModelSim版本,并且熟悉如何通过命令行界面操作ModelSim。
1. **添加ALTERA仿真库:**
- 打开ModelSim命令行界面。
- 使用`vlib`命令创建ALTERA库,例如输入命令`vlib altera_lib`。
- 使用`vmap`命令将新创建的库映射到ALTERA的路径,例如输入命令`vmap altera_lib <path_to_altera_lib>`。
2. **编译ALTERA库中的设计单元:**
- 使用`vcom`命令编译ALTERA库中的设计单元文件,例如`vcom -work work altera_lib/<design_unit.vhd>`。
3. **编写DO文件:**
- 在文本编辑器中创建一个名为`run仿真.do`的文件。
- 在DO文件中,输入编译和仿真命令。例如:
```
vcom -work work altera_lib/<design_unit.vhd>
vsim -L altera_lib -L work work.<design_unit>
add wave -position end sim:/<design_unit>/<signal_name>
run -all
```
- 保存DO文件,并将其放置在你的工作目录中。
4. **执行DO文件进行功能仿真:**
- 在ModelSim命令行界面中,使用`do`命令执行DO文件,例如输入命令`do run仿真.do`。
- ModelSim将自动编译设计单元,加载仿真,并显示波形窗口。
通过以上步骤,你可以在ModelSimSE中添加ALTERA仿真库,并使用DO文件来进行功能仿真。这种方法不仅结构清晰,而且便于在项目中重复使用。
要了解更多关于ModelSim的基础操作和高级技巧,可以参阅《ModelSim学习笔记:初学者指南》。这本指南不仅涵盖了上述问题的解决方案,还提供了一个全面的初学者框架,帮助你掌握ModelSim的使用方法和最佳实践。
参考资源链接:[ModelSim学习笔记:初学者指南](https://wenku.csdn.net/doc/sjuzgy8b58?spm=1055.2569.3001.10343)
阅读全文